Yesterday was St Swithin's Day, the day on which people watch the weather as tradition says that the weather on that day will continue for the next forty days! Given that it started raining last night, looks like we are in for a wet summer.

'St. Swithin's day if thou dost rain
For forty days it will remain
St. Swithin's day if thou be fair
For forty days 'twill rain nae mair.'

St Swithin was the Saxon Bishop of Winchester. Legend says that on his deathbed he asked to be buried out of doors where he would be walked on and rained on (Bishops always seem to be interred in church crypts). For nine years his wish was granted until the monks decided to remove his remains to a special shrine inside the cathedral. According to legend there was a heavy storm during the ceremony or on its anniversary. Hence the folklore tale that if it rains on St Swithin's day it will rain for 40 days. Quite why 40 days, history does not relate!
